CPTSA Wings Sports Club Newsletter #15

Issue #15 January 31, 2010

More Parental Involvement Needed in Sports

What kind of society are we building if parents don't give the time to show support to their own kids? That's the number one question sports administrators ask frequently. Where are the parents? As for the Wings Sports Club, thanks to the few parents who show up to support their young athletes at practice, games, meetings and fundraising. But many others are still invisible.

The Wings coaches have professions and famillies, yet they voluntarily give their time at least five days a week, to work with children. The children deserve more. On Saturday, January 30, the Wings U-13 team participated in the Young Warriors Football Extravaganza at Buckleys. Wings went under 2-1 in the first game against the Young Warriors and drew nil all against Willikies.

Find a local sport in your community and show your support.  Even if you don't have children of your own, it's always a good way to spend the day.
